How to Make Banana Coconut Cookie Bars

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9x13 inch baking pan.
  2. In a large bowl, mash bananas until mostly smooth. Add melted butter, sugar, and eggs; mix well.
  3. Stir in vanilla extract, flour, baking soda, and salt until just combined. Be careful not to overmix.
  4. Fold in shredded coconut, cookie crumbs, and chocolate chips.
  5. Pour batter into prepared pan and spread evenly.
  6.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s.
  7. Let cool completely before cutting into bars.
